I have used Hella QH headlights for about 30 years & swear by them.
A high quality product with a really good reflector. The ones in my 1200 coupe were salvaged from my old B10 sedan & installed in my son's 120Y. When he sold it I recovered them & installed them in my coupe. I run only the standard 60/55 watt bulbs & with a relay, & they are the best lights I have ever used. The downside? Not cheap. A little hard to find right now. [A small hole in one from a stone means I will need a replacement & Repco don't handle them anymore.]
